What is Mitochondrial Dysfunction?
Mitochondrial dysfunction takes place when these organelles do not operate at ideal effectiveness, resulting in inadequate ATP production and energy deficits in cells. Mitochondrial dysfunction can emerge from different factors, which can be broadly categorized into genetic, environmental, and lifestyle-related causes:
1. Hereditary Factors
Genetic anomalies can result in inherited mitochondrial diseases or syndromes that impair mitochondrial function. These genes are typically situated in the mitochondrial DNA (mtDNA) or nuclear DNA (nDNA).
2. Environmental Factors
Exposure to toxins, heavy metals, and contaminants can damage mitochondrial structures and hinder their function.
3. Lifestyle Factors
Poor diet plan, lack of exercise, and chronic stress can contribute to mitochondrial dysfunction. The intake of processed foods, extreme sugar, and unhealthy fats might worsen the decrease of mitochondrial health.

Yes, mitochondrial dysfunction can be acquired due to mutations in mitochondrial DNA or nuclear DNA related to mitochondrial function.
Q2: How is mitochondrial dysfunction diagnosed?
Medical diagnosis usually includes scientific evaluations, blood tests, and hereditary screening. Muscle biopsies may also be performed in some cases.
Q3: Are there specific diseases associated with mitochondrial dysfunction?
Yes, various conditions such as mitochondrial myopathy, Leigh syndrome, and Kearns-Sayre syndrome are directly linked to mitochondrial dysfunction.
Q4: Can lifestyle changes reverse mitochondrial dysfunction?
While way of life modifications can not "reverse" mitochondrial dysfunction, they can substantially improve mitochondrial function and enhance energy levels.
Q5: What function do anti-oxidants play in mitochondrial health?
Antioxidants assist reduce the effects of reactive oxygen types (ROS) generated by mitochondria, decreasing oxidative tension and securing mitochondrial integrity.
